Как мне написать условные выражения ifeq ($ (filter-tt _%, $ (TARGET_PRODUCT)),) в android.bp - PullRequest
0 голосов
/ 11 апреля 2019

Как обрабатывать приведенный ниже код в Android.bp?Мне нужно включить условный флаг на основе выбранного Target_product.Я поделился своим Android.mk, аналогичная логика должна быть обработана в Android.bp.

В Android.mk ниже указан код

ifeq ($(filter-out ctt_%,$(TARGET_PRODUCT)),)

LOCAL_CFLAGS += -DCTT_BUILD

else ifeq ($(filter-out ihu_%,$(TARGET_PRODUCT)),)

LOCAL_CFLAGS += -DPHU_BUILD

LOCAL_SRC_FILES +=vendor_cmds.c
LOCAL_C_INCLUDES += vendor_cmds.h
endif

Заранее спасибо.

Ваши ответы действительно приветствуются.

...